How much can you earn on Airbnb in Avalon Beach, New South Wales? Based on AirROI's 2026 dataset (July 2025 – June 2026), the short answer is $25,903 per year — at a $402 nightly rate, 43.6% occupancy, and a $163 RevPAR that reflects moderate rate-to-revenue efficiency with room to optimize.

With just 24 active listings, Avalon Beach is a micro-market where moderate demand with room for well-positioned listings to outperform.

Regulation is high and 100% of listings show active registration — compliance is the cost of entry. In a market this size, differentiated listings with strong reviews can capture outsized returns relative to the competition.

How Much Do Airbnb Hosts Earn Monthly in Avalon Beach?

Understanding the monthly revenue variations for Airbnb listings in Avalon Beach is key to maximizing your short term rental income potential. Seasonality significantly impacts earnings. Our analysis, based on data from the past 12 months, shows that the peak revenue month for STRs in Avalon Beach is typically December, while August often presents the lowest earnings, highlighting opportunities for strategic pricing adjustments during shoulder and low seasons. Explore the typical Airbnb income in Avalon Beach across different performance tiers:

  •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ve $7,379+ monthly, often utilizing dynamic pricing and superior guest experiences.
  • Strong performing properties (Top 25%) earn $5,407 or more, indicating effective management and desirable locations/amenities.
  • Typical properties (Median) generate around $2,866 per month, representing the average market performance.
  •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) see earnings around $1,669, often with potential for optimization.

When Is the Peak Season for Airbnb in Avalon Beach?

Avalon Beach's peak Airbnb season falls in December, March, January, while the softest stretch is August, September, November. Overall, the market shows highly seasonal trends requiring careful strategy, which should guide pricing, minimum stays, and cash-flow planning.

Peak Season (December, March, January)
  • Revenue averages $6,359 per month
  • Occupancy rates average 52.8%
  • Daily rates average $415
Shoulder Season
  • Revenue averages $3,865 per month
  • Occupancy maintains around 36.4%
  • Daily rates hold near $414
Low Season (August, September, November)
  • Revenue drops to average $1,802 per month
  • Occupancy decreases to average 22.8%
  • Daily rates adjust to average $406

Seasonality Insights for Avalon Beach

  • Airbnb seasonality in Avalon Beach is pronounced. Revenue swings sharply between peak and low months, which means pricing strategy, minimum-stay settings, and cash reserves all need to account for extended slower periods.
  • During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Avalon Beach's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ues climbing to $7,471, occupancy reaching 60.8%, and ADRs peaking at $431.
  • Conversely, the slowest single month marks the market's lowest point — revenue may dip to $1,000, occupancy could drop to 14.6%, and ADRs may adjust to $402.
  • Understanding both the seasonal averages and these monthly peaks and troughs in revenue, occupancy, and ADR is crucial for maximizing your Airbnb profit potential in Avalon Beach.

Which Airbnb Amenities Boost Revenue in Avalon Beach?

Not every amenity matters equally. This table focuses on the amenities most associated with higher revenue in Avalon Beach, which makes it more useful for prioritizing upgrades than a simple popularity list alone.

AmenityPrevalenceRevenue WithRevenue WithoutRevenue Uplift
BBQ grill
58.3%$36,143$11,569212.4%
Barbecue utensils
45.8%$39,654$14,268177.9%
Sound system
29.2%$43,947$18,474137.9%
Body soap
70.8%$31,039$13,431131.1%
Pool
20.8%$43,035$21,395101.1%
Outdoor dining area
62.5%$31,317$16,88085.5%
Fire extinguisher
70.8%$29,871$16,26983.6%
Dishwasher
50.0%$33,515$18,29283.2%
Outdoor shower
25.0%$39,116$21,49981.9%
Carbon monoxide alarm
20.8%$40,124$22,16181.1%

Revenue Impact Insights for Avalon Beach

  • BBQ grill tops the revenue impact list with a 212.4% uplift — listings with this amenity earn $36,143 vs. $11,569 without it.

How Much Are Airbnb Cleaning Fees in Avalon Beach?

Cleaning fees in Avalon Beach are meaningful operating levers, not just pass-through charges. What matters most is how often hosts charge them, how high they run relative to market norms, and how large a share of gross revenue they consume.

Average Cleaning Fee
$181
Median Cleaning Fee
$100
Listings Charging a Fee
83.3%
Fee as Revenue Share
7.2%

Cleaning Fee Insights for Avalon Beach

  • 83.3% of listings charge a cleaning fee, making it standard practice in Avalon Beach. Guests expect it and factor it into their booking decisions.
  • The gap between the average ($181) and median ($100) cleaning fee indicates some high-end properties are pulling the average up considerably.
  • Cleaning fees represent 7.2% of gross revenue on average — a modest component of the overall booking price.
